Solve for x in x² - 5x + 6 = 0 using the Quadratic Formula. a. x = 5, 6 b. x = 2,3 c. x = 1,6 d. x = -2, -3 e. x = -1, -6

Answers

Answer 1

To solve the quadratic equation x² - 5x + 6 = 0, we can use the Quadratic Formula. The correct solutions for x can be determined by substituting the coefficients into the formula and simplifying.

The Quadratic Formula is used to find the solutions of a quadratic equation of the form ax² + bx + c = 0, where a, b, and c are coefficients. The formula is given by:

x = (-b ± √(b² - 4ac)) / (2a)

For the equation x² - 5x + 6 = 0, we can identify a = 1, b = -5, and c = 6. Substituting these values into the Quadratic Formula:

x = (-(-5) ± √((-5)² - 4(1)(6))) / (2(1))

= (5 ± √(25 - 24)) / 2

= (5 ± √1) / 2

= (5 ± 1) / 2

Simplifying further, we get two possible solutions for x:

x₁ = (5 + 1) / 2 = 6 / 2 = 3

x₂ = (5 - 1) / 2 = 4 / 2 = 2

Therefore, the solutions for x in the quadratic equation x² - 5x + 6 = 0 are x = 3 and x = 2. Comparing these solutions to the given options, we can see that the correct answer is b. x = 2, 3.

A principal of $12,000 is invested in an account paying an annual interest rate of 7%. Find the amount in the account after 4 years if the account is compounded quarterly.

Answers

The amount in the account after 4 years, compounded quarterly, is approximately $14,920.03.

To find the amount in the account after 4 years, compounded quarterly, we can use the formula for compound interest: A = P(1 + r/n)^(nt)

Where:

A = the final amount

P = the principal amount

r = the annual interest rate (in decimal form)

n = the number of times the interest is compounded per year

t = the number of years

In this case, the principal amount P is $12,000, the annual interest rate r is 7% or 0.07, the number of times compounded per year n is 4 (quarterly), and the number of years t is 4. Plugging these values into the formula, we get: A = 12000(1 + 0.07/4)^(4*4)

Simplifying the calculation inside the parentheses first:

A = 12000(1 + 0.0175)^(16)

A = 12000(1.0175)^(16)

Using a calculator, we find: A ≈ $14,920.03

Therefore, the amount in the account after 4 years, compounded quarterly, is approximately $14,920.03.

Find the equation of the curve passing through (1,0) if the slope is given by the following. Assume that x>0. dy/dx = 3/x³ + 4/x-1
y(x)= (Simplify your answer. Use integers or fractions for any numbers in the expression)

Answers

The equation of the curve passing through (1,0) can be found by integrating the given slope function with respect to x and then applying the initial condition.

To find the equation of the curve, we integrate the given slope function with respect to x. The given slope function is dy/dx = 3/x³ + 4/(x-1). Integrating both sides, we obtain:

∫dy = ∫(3/x³ + 4/(x-1))dx

Integrating each term separately, we get:

y = ∫(3/x³)dx + ∫(4/(x-1))dx

Simplifying, we have:

y = -1/x² + 4ln|x-1| + C

where C is the constant of integration. To find the value of C, we use the initial condition that the curve passes through (1,0). Substituting x = 1 and y = 0 into the equation, we have:

0 = -1/1² + 4ln|1-1| + C

0 = -1 + C

Therefore, C = 1. Substituting the value of C back into the equation, we obtain the final equation of the curve :

y = -1/x² + 4ln|x-1| + 1

This is the equation of the curve passing through (1,0) with the given slope function.

Triangle ABC has vertices at A(−5, 2), B(1, 3), and C(−3, 0). Determine the coordinates of the vertices for the image if the preimage is translated 4 units right.

A′(−9, 2), B′(−3, 3), C′(−7, 0)
A′(−4, 6), B′(0, 7), C′(−5, 4)
A′(−1, 2), B′(5, 3), C′(1, 0)
A′(−5, −2), B′(1, −1), C′(−3, −4)

Answers

Answer:

Option 3: A'(-1, 2), B'(5, 3), C'(1, 0)

Step-by-step explanation:

The triangle is translated 4 units RIGHT, so we will be dealing with the x-values of the vertices of the triangle.

4 units right indicates, we are ADDING 4 to the x-values, because we are moving in the positive direction.

A(-5, 2) becomes A'(-5+4, 2) = A'(-1, 2)

B(1, 3) becomes B'(1+4, 3) = B'(5, 3)

C(-3, 0) becomes C'(-3+4, 0) = C'(1, 0)

One of the steps Jamie used to solve an equation is shown below. -5(3x + 7) = 10 -15x +-35 = 10 Which statements describe the procedure Jamie used in this step and identify the property that justifies the procedure?
AJamie multiplied 3x and 7 by -5 to eliminate the parentheses. This procedure is justified by the associative property.
B Jamie added -5 and 3x to eliminate the parentheses. This procedure is justified by the associative property.
C Jamie multiplied 3x and 7 by -5 to eliminate the parentheses. This procedure is justified by the distributive property.
D Jamie added -5 and 3x to eliminate the parentheses. This procedure is justified by the distributive property.​

Answers

Answer:

The correct answer is C: Jamie multiplied 3x and 7 by -5 to eliminate the parentheses. This procedure is justified by the distributive property.

Step-by-step explanation:
In the given step, Jamie multiplied each term inside the parentheses (3x and 7) by -5. This multiplication is performed to distribute the -5 to both terms within the parentheses, resulting in -15x and -35. This procedure is justified by the distributive property, which states that when a number is multiplied by a sum or difference inside parentheses, it can be distributed to each term within the parentheses.

Two vectors [1 3] and [2 c] form a basis for R² if a) c = 2 b) c = 3 c) c = 4 d) c = 6 e) None of the above IfT : R² → R² is a linear transformation such that T ([1 2]) = [2 3], then T([3 6]) = a) [6 9] b) [3 6] c) [4 5]
d) [4 6] e) None of the above.

Answers

ToTo determine if the vectors [1 3] and [2 c] form a basis for R², we need to check if the vectors are linearly independent. If the vectors are linearly independent, they will span the entire R², making them a basis.

We can find the determinant of the matrix formed by these vectors:

| 1 3 |
| 2 c |

The determinant of this matrix is given by:

1 * c – 2 * 3 = c – 6

For the vectors to be linearly independent, the determinant should not be equal to zero. Let’s evaluate the determinant for different values of c:

a) C = 2:
C – 6 = 2 – 6 = -4 (non-zero)

b) C = 3:
C – 6 = 3 – 6 = -3 (non-zero)

c) C = 4:
C – 6 = 4 – 6 = -2 (non-zero)

d) C = 6:
C – 6 = 6 – 6 = 0 (zero)

From the above calculations, we can see that for c = 6, the determinant is equal to zero, indicating that the vectors [1 3] and [2 6] are linearly dependent. Therefore, they do not form a basis for R².

Now, let’s move on to the second part of the question.

Given that T([1 2]) = [2 3], we can find the transformation T([3 6]) using the linearity property of linear transformations.

We know that the transformation T is linear, so T(k * v) = k * T(v) for any scalar k and vector v.

Since [3 6] = 3 * [1 2], we can apply the linearity property:

T([3 6]) = 3 * T([1 2])

Using the information given, T([1 2]) = [2 3].

Therefore:

T([3 6]) = 3 * [2 3] = [6 9]

So, T([3 6]) = [6 9].
